OpenAI Becomes World’s Largest Startup | Bloomberg Tech 10/2/2025
OpenAI has made headlines by becoming the world's largest startup, achieving a staggering $500 billion valuation after allowing employees to sell shares. This milestone is significant as it highlights the growing influence and financial power of AI companies in the tech landscape. In related news, Tesla has set a new record for vehicle sales globally, driven by a surge in purchases before US tax credits expired. Additionally, Microsoft is making strides in the cloud sector with over $33 billion in commitments to neocloud providers, addressing the increasing demand for AI data center capacity.

Tesla Is Sued by Family Who Says Faulty Cybertruck Doors Led to Woman’s Death
NegativeTechnology
A tragic lawsuit has emerged against Tesla, alleging that faulty electronic doors on a Cybertruck contributed to the death of a college student who was trapped in a burning vehicle. The family claims that the innovative design, which allows doors to open with the push of a button, failed to function properly, preventing her escape and rescue. This case raises serious questions about the safety of advanced automotive technology and the responsibilities of manufacturers to ensure their products do not pose a danger to users.
